Distance from Wrocław to Albacete

There are several ways to calculate the distance from Wrocław to Albacete. Here are two standard methods:

Vincenty's formula (applied above)
  • 1237.332 miles
  • 1991.293 kilometers
  • 1075.212 nautical miles

Vincenty's formula calculates the distance between latitude/longitude points on the earth's surface using an ellipsoidal model of the planet.

Haversine formula
  • 1235.799 miles
  • 1988.825 kilometers
  • 1073.880 nautical miles

The haversine formula calculates the distance between latitude/longitude points assuming a spherical earth (great-circle distance – the shortest distance between two points).
